Abstract
The invention is a computer implemented system and process for managing a threaded instant messaging conversation. The process comprises establishing an interactive messaging session for exchanging a conversation element; assigning a thread identifier to the conversation element; appending the thread identifier to the conversation element; and displaying the conversation element in a user interface based on the thread identifier.
